Make your life easier with the Rubit! Curved Dog Tag Clip. This simple and stylish clip lets you easily transition your dog’s tags to different collars without any hassle. Designed to be tough enough for years of trips to the dog-park, this aluminum clip is built with adventures in mind so you don’t have to worry about losing your pup’s tags unexpectedly. The secure latch keeps this clip fastened to your dog’s collar and is easily removed to avoid jingling tags at night!

Really like these clips. Already hade a couple for my standard poodles. One finally broke but only because someone kept attaching the leash to the clip instead of the collar (they don't stand up to that kind of strain). Recently bought a new one to use for attaching a temporary tag to dogs that I dogsit. I got the small size to use with small dogs, but the mouth is actually just wide enough that it has so far fit the D rings on the large dog collars too.

The clip is well designed and easy to use. I ordered the small and when it arrived it was definitely small. I was a little worried it wouldn’t fit on the d-ring of the collar but there were no issues. It’s easy to put on and take off. While I loved it and thought it was great, my pup did too. Finally she could get at those pesky tags that jangle! She decided she’d show them who was the boss by chewing on them since the clip gave enough length for her to reach them. Sadly that means we’re back to attaching her tags directly to her collar’s d-ring, but only due to her insistenace on trying to eat them. Great product but just not for her.
